Types of Integrated Circuits: Digital, Analog, Mixed Signal, and RF
Integrated Circuits come in different types, and each type has specific functions and features. Most common types of ICs include digital, analog, mixed signal, and RF. Digital circuits are used for information processing and controlling digital equipment. Analog circuits, on the other hand, process continuous-time signals like audio and video. Mixed-signal circuits combine analog and digital signal processing. RF circuits are designed to transmit, receive, or process radio frequency signals.
